A Parent's Guide To Checking MySpace

Myspace is free but you must register.

Go to MySpace.com, and click on "Sign Up." Fill out the form and you're a member.

To find your child's MySpace page, the easiest thing to do is to click on "Search." Then, click on search using e-mail.

Type in your son or daughter's entire e-mail address, for example "Ryan@aol.com."

You should be brought to their home page. Click on "View Profile."

Usually, friends' messages are on the bottom right of the page. If you click on a friend's picture or icon, you will be taken to that friend's MySpace page.

Remember, experts have said you should warn your child that you are going to look at their Web site, and be prepared to talk reasonably about how they present themselves on the Web.

They must also be aware of any dangers or repercussions they may face if they are too provocative or revealing. You don't want to end up alienating your child; just let them know you are showing concern.
